Structure and properties of M/sup I/M/sub 2//sup IV/(PO/sub 4/)/sub 3/ in quadrivalent actinoid phosphates

1987 
A survey is presented on the crystallographic and IR features of double actinoid-alkali phosphates of the form M/sup (I)/M/sub 2//sup (IV)/ (PO/sub 4/)/sub 3/; it is found that the compounds Li/sup -/, Na/sup -/, K/sup -/, Rb/sup -/, CsTh/sub 2/(PO/sub 4/)/sub 3/, Li/sup -/, Na/sup -/, KU/sub 2/(PO/sub 4/)/sub 3/, NaNp/sub 2/(PO/sub 4/)/sub 3/ have monoclinic structures and form an isostructural series. Double salts do not occur in the uranium-rubidium and uranium-cesium systems. Sodium plutonium phosphate is orthorhombic, which indicates a morphotropic transition in the NaM/sub 2//sup (IV)/ (PO/sub 4/)/sub 3/ series at the Np-Pu boundary. Some regularities have been established in the structures and effects of M/sup (I)/ and M/sup (IV)/.
